Abstract: Real-time holography is a fast-developing technique forcorrection of dynamic and static aberrations in imagingtelescopes. In this paper a novel schematic ofrecording the hologram is discussed based on the use ofphase conjugation for compensation for dynamicdistortions in the real-time hologram. This techniquecan improve significantly the quality of the correctedimage of remote objects and allows to use opticallyinhomogeneous materials for recording the real timehologram and segmented design of the holographiccorrector.!28
